Quick Start Guide

Set up your oven
Make sure your oven racks are in place prior to operating the range. Check out your Use & Care Guide.
Set your clock
It’s easy! Press SET CLOCK, enter the time using numeric keys, then press OK/START.
Before cooking for the first time
Set your oven to bake at 350°F for about 30 minutes. As the range gets settled in your home, it’s
normal to experience some noises and smoke.
Use a ceramic cooktop cleaning cream before cooking for the first time to protect your cooktop from
scratches.

YOU’RE IN CONTROL
Do not use aluminum foil or any other materials to line any part of the oven.
All oven racks should be removed before a self clean operation.
Do not add bleach, ammonia, oven cleaner, or any other abrasive household
cleaners to the water used for Steam Clean.
REMEMBER
1. Bake - Use to select Bake feature.
2. Broil - Use to set Broil feature.
3. Air Fry - Uses super hot air circulating around food to produce crispy
golden results.
4. Conv Bake - Circulates the oven heat evenly and continuously for faster
cooking of some foods.
5. Conv Roast - Uses a convection fan to gently brown meats and poultry and
seal in the juices.
6. Quick Preheat - Best used for single rack baking with packaged and
convenience foods.
7. Timer O-On - Use to set or cancel the minute timer. The minute timer does
not start or stop any cooking function.
8. Probe - Use to set and adjust temperatures when using probe.
9. Keep Warm - Use to keep cooked foods at serving temperature.
10. Convect Convert - Use to change standard bake recipe to a convection bake
recipe.
11. Oven Light - Use to turn on internal light when checking on food. Also will
turn on when the oven door is open.
12. Oven Lock - Use to lock out oven controls.
13. Self Clean - Use with arrow keys to set self clean cycle of 2, 3, or 4hrs.
14. Steam Clean - Use for cleaning light soils.
15. Set Clock - Use set the time of day
16. Delay Start - Add to Quick Preheat, Bake, Convection Bake, Convection
Roast, or Self Clean features to program a delay start time.
17. Add A Min -Use to add additional minutes to the timer.
18. 0 through 9 keys - Use to set temperature and time.
19. OFF - Use to clear any feature except the time of day and minute timer.
20. START - Use to start most oven features.
